Women’s tennis (7-10, 3-8) faced a tough matchup April 3 against No. 26 Notre Dame (10-11, 4-8) and ultimately fell 4-3 to the Fighting Irish at the Eck Tennis Pavilion. 

Notre Dame ended up taking the doubles point with wins on courts two and three. 

Julia Andreach and Yashna Yelleyi (ND) defeated junior Dina Chaika and senior Chelsea Sawyer 6-2. 

The doubles point was clinched when No. 27 graduate student Raven Neely and sophomore Tatiana Simova fell 6-3 to No. 16 Ally Bojczuk and Julia Lilien (ND). 

On court one, sophomore Andrea Di Palma and junior Rhea Verma were down 5-3 against No. 17 Page Freeman and Cameron Corse (ND). 

To kick off singles, Neely secured a 6-3, 6-3 win over Bojczuk.

Notre Dame took a one-point-lead over the Cards as Corse (ND) defeated senior Nikolina Jovic 6-2, 6-2.

Louisville fought back on court five as Verma topped Andreach (ND) 6-2, 6-3.

Di Palma put the Cards in the lead with a 7-6, 6-2 win over No. 78 Freeman (ND).

The Fighting Irish then took over courts four and six to win the match.

On court four, Sawyer fell 6-0, 6-2 to Lilien (ND), and Chaika fell 6-4, 3-6, 6-3 in a hard-fought match against Yellayi (ND).
